WebFeb 1, 2024 · Traveling with CBD: The Importance of THC Level The 2024 Farm Bill explicitly states that industrial hemp must have a maximum of 0.3 percent THC by dry weight. Any Cannabis sativa L. plant containing more is automatically classified as marijuana, a federally illegal substance.

WebMay 31, 2024 · For example, you can travel into Germany and Greece with a CBD product as long as it contains less than 0.2% THC, The Netherlands only allows 0.05% and France doesn’t permit any THC at all. Please check each country’s laws or simply travel with a low or no THC product.
